When the Start button is pressed, the washer will perform a self-test on the lid lock. You will hear a click, the basket slightly turns, and the lid will unlock briefly before locking again. Next, the washer will use short, slow spins to estimate the load size. These sensing spins may take 2 to 3 minutes before adding water to the load.

If your top load washing machine (or some older front load washers) is stuck on one continuous cycle and will not advance and forward to the next wash cycle, then most likely the washer timer is faulty and needs replacement. The timer on your washing machine controls all aspects of the wash, spin, and rinse cycles. Step 1: Check the selected spin speed. If you find that your clothing is coming out of the wash cycle more wet than usual, double-check the selected spin speed setting. Both gentle and delicate spin speeds use a slow spin to prevent fabrics from getting stretched or wrinkled, leaving more water behind in the load. Let’s take a look at some of the factors. …Cycle time may be longer during water fill when using the Bulky Cycle, depending on the load size. The Bulky Cycle uses a series of fills while agitating. It may appear that there is not enough water to wash a bulky load, but the washer will continue to add water while its sensors monitor the load. It could take up to 10-12 minutes to fill.1. Let the large capacity washer guide you to the right cycle combinations or customize Is the lid locked? The lid must be completely closed and latched for the washer to operate. Depending on your model, some washers may fill without the lid locking, and others will not even start until the lid locks. Check your Owner's Manual for information on your specific model. CLICK HERE for more information on the lid locking.If F8 E1 or LF (too long to fill) appears in the display, the washer is taking too long to fill or the washer is filling and draining. It's possible the drain hose extends more than 4.5" (114 mm) into the standpipe. Check the plumbing for the correct drain hose installation.
